also, regarding the injured picketers, I spoke to a GMB rep and he told me how it happened:
During the picket a delivery truck came out of the compound and of course picketers gave the scab some abuse. This guy tried to be clever and thought of reaching out from his cabin while driving pass the picket and give abuse and i dont know maybe hit someone or grab a placard.
While he was doing this, he wasn't paying attention to his driving and the back part of the truck hit a porable cabin. Three strikers were next to that cabin and got swept away by the force which destroyed the cabin as well.
